Job Description

Social Media Manager, Quantum Tech

NVision Imaging Technologies

• Managing and growing the social media presence for NVision across LinkedIn, X (Twitter), and other relevant technology platforms. • Creating engaging, social-first content by translating complex quantum technology and its applications into clear, compelling stories for different audiences. • Supporting major announcements, research and white paper releases, and campaigns through impactful, audience-first storytelling. • Collaborating closely with Research, Marketing, and Design teams to plan and execute campaigns, announcements, and content initiatives. • Monitor quantum tech trends and scientific community sentiment to identify and translate real-time opportunities into timely, relevant content ideas. • Actively engaging with our community by responding to comments and messages, joining relevant technical and industry conversations, and helping build a loyal and engaged following. • Tracking performance metrics, analysing results, and continuously optimising content strategies to drive growth and engagement.

Job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ience managing social media for deep-tech companies, including introducing new technologies to the market.
  • A strong interest in quantum technology, human health, and emerging tech communities, with the ability to translate complex scientific and engineering topics into clear, engaging, and compliant content.
  • An understanding of social-first content to quickly identify trends, high-performing formats, and what drives professional engagement.
  • Exceptional copywriting skills to craft short, impactful content that aligns with the brand tone.
  • Basic video creating and editing skills to create social-first videos that drive engagement across platforms, particularly LinkedIn.
  • A curious and proactive mindset, always exploring new formats, trends, and opportunities to contribute fresh ideas.
  • Experience using social media management and scheduling tools, such as Sprout.
  • A data-driven approach, with experience using analytics tools to track performance and optimise content strategies.
  • Excellent attention to detail and organisational skills, with the ability to manage multiple deadlines and projects simultaneously.
  • Fluency in English with exceptional written and verbal communication skills.
  • A collaborative, team-first attitude to work cross-functionally in a fast-paced, global team environment.
  • Experience with design tools, such as Adobe and Figma or Canva for video, is considered an advantage.
  • Experience writing for a highly technical audience or within a regulated industry is considered an advantage.
